首先参照图1至图21,这些示出体现本发明许多方面的表面清洁设备10的第一实施例。简而言之,设备10包括主体12、位于主体12第一端部处的第一轮14和位于主体12相对第二端部处的第二轮16。轮可围绕相应的轮轴线旋转。主体12是大体圆柱形的并具有在轮14,16之间沿着主体12纵向长度延伸的大体细长轴线A。Referring first to FIGS. 1-21 , these illustrate a first embodiment of a surface cleaning apparatus 10 embodying many aspects of the present invention. Briefly, device 10 includes a body 12 , a first wheel 14 at a first end of body 12 , and a second wheel 16 at an opposite second end of body 12 . The wheels are rotatable about respective wheel axes. The body 12 is generally cylindrical and has a generally elongated axis A extending along the longitudinal length of the body 12 between the wheels 14 , 16 .
主体12成形为使得其外表面大体是凹入的,其外表面围绕轴线A周向地延伸。更详细地,在该特定实施例中,主体12具有中央区域C,其具有坐落在中央区域C和每个轮14,16之间的相应的侧面部分R,L。从附图可以看出每个部分R,L的半径Y随着该部分的外表面从中央区域C朝向每个轮14,16延伸而增加,换言之,部分R,L随它们朝向轮14,16延伸而向外扩展。The body 12 is shaped such that its outer surface, which extends circumferentially around the axis A, is generally concave. In more detail, in this particular embodiment, the body 12 has a central region C with respective side portions R, L situated between the central region C and each wheel 14 , 16 . It can be seen from the figures that the radius Y of each part R, L increases as the outer surface of the part extends from the central region C towards each wheel 14, 16, in other words, the parts R, L increase as they move towards the wheels 14, 16. Extend and expand outward.
应当理解的是,主体12的形状确保在主体12的外表面的面对地板的部分上设置大体凹入的部分,当设备被定位在地板表面F上两个轮14,16接触地板表面F时,所述大体凹入的部分提供空间S。空间S提供适于偏置装置80的空间/凹部,这将在下文进行更详细地论述。It will be appreciated that the shape of the body 12 ensures that a generally concave portion is provided on the floor-facing portion of the outer surface of the body 12 when the device is positioned on the floor surface F when the two wheels 14, 16 contact the floor surface F , the generally concave portion provides a space S. Space S provides a space/recess for biasing means 80, which will be discussed in more detail below.
虽然在当前实例中,主体12关于横向延伸通过中央部分C和轴线A的平面大体对称,但是应当理解的是,在不脱离本发明范围的情况下也可以采用主体12的其它形状。不必是主体12的外表面关于轴线A大体对称的情况。例如,主体12可成形为使得在主体和地板表面F之间提供空间S,而主体12的面向上的表面不设有任何凹入部分等(例如它可是外凸的)。在该特定的实例中,有利的是使得第一轮14和第二轮16的地面接合表面的半径当横向于轴线A测量时大于主体的最大宽度。这确保当设备在使用中时主体不弄脏地板表面F。Although in the present example, body 12 is generally symmetrical about a plane extending transversely through central portion C and axis A, it should be understood that other shapes for body 12 may be employed without departing from the scope of the present invention. It need not be the case that the outer surface of the body 12 is generally symmetrical about the axis A. For example, the body 12 may be shaped such that a space S is provided between the body and the floor surface F, without the upwardly facing surface of the body 12 being provided with any concave portions or the like (eg it may be convex). In this particular example, it is advantageous that the radii of the ground engaging surfaces of the first wheel 14 and the second wheel 16, when measured transversely to the axis A, are greater than the maximum width of the body. This ensures that the body does not soil the floor surface F when the device is in use.
主体12容纳吸力马达140,吸入式风扇150,第一旋风分离器装置110,第二旋风分离器装置210以及用于接收和存储污物的腔室100。这些组成部件的位置和形状和它们的相互作用将在下文进行更详细地论述。主体12由塑料材料诸如丙烯腈-丁二烯-苯乙烯(ABS)制成。材料是不透明的,但它也可以由半透明或透明材料制成,以允许给用户提供腔室100内污物水平的视觉指示。轮由橡胶材料制成。The main body 12 houses the suction motor 140, the suction fan 150, the first cyclone separator device 110, the second cyclone separator device 210 and the chamber 100 for receiving and storing dirt. The location and shape of these component parts and their interaction are discussed in more detail below. The main body 12 is made of a plastic material such as acrylonitrile-butadiene-styrene (ABS). The material is opaque, but it could also be made of a translucent or transparent material to allow the user to be given a visual indication of the level of contamination within the chamber 100 . The wheels are made of rubber material.

导管20包括连接到该设备的主要空气入口70的柔性部段。主入口70基本上定位在第一轮14和第二轮16的中间,并在正常使用中垂直向下延伸通过主体的外表面并进入到主体12的内部中。The conduit 20 comprises a flexible section connected to the main air inlet 70 of the device. The main inlet 70 is located substantially midway between the first wheel 14 and the second wheel 16 and extends vertically downward through the outer surface of the body and into the interior of the body 12 in normal use.
具体参照图15,主要空气入口通过通道/入口72连接到通到第一旋风分离器装置110的入口,以便将进入的空气(含有污物颗粒等)在箭头的方向71上引导,直到它进入第一旋风分离器装置110。Referring specifically to Figure 15, the main air inlet is connected by a channel/inlet 72 to the inlet to the first cyclone separator means 110 so as to direct the incoming air (containing dirt particles etc.) in the direction of the arrow 71 until it enters the First cyclone separator unit 110 .
在当前实施例中,第一旋风分离器装置110是“抛掉”分离器,其操作在本领域内是公知的。分离器装置110具有进入到大体圆柱形腔室112内的切向入口72,其具有与轴线A.共轴的轴线。污物出口113在周边定位在腔室112的一个端部(最靠近轮14的端部)处,并且装置110还包括空气出口114,其也大体是圆柱形的,具有孔115,空气通过孔115在箭头116(与轴线A共轴)的方向上传送到第二旋风分离器装置210(在下文详细论述)。In the current embodiment, the first cyclone device 110 is a "throw-away" separator, the operation of which is well known in the art. The separator device 110 has a tangential inlet 72 into a generally cylindrical chamber 112 having an axis coaxial with the axis A. A dirt outlet 113 is located peripherally at one end of the chamber 112 (the end closest to the wheel 14), and the device 110 also includes an air outlet 114, also generally cylindrical, with a hole 115 through which air passes. 115 is passed in the direction of arrow 116 (coaxial with axis A) to a second cyclone arrangement 210 (discussed in detail below).
腔室112位于用于接收污物的腔室100内,并且污物出口113与腔室100流体连通,使得污物能够通过其并进入到腔室100内。A chamber 112 is located within the chamber 100 for receiving dirt, and a dirt outlet 113 is in fluid communication with the chamber 100 such that dirt can pass therethrough and into the chamber 100 .
所述污物出口113配置成用于将污物在方向111上引导到腔室100内,方向111大体与空气进入主要空气入口70的方向相反。具体地,污物大体反向平行于空气流动的方向被引导到主要空气入口70内。通过示例性说明的方式,当设备处于操作状态下并且两个轮14,16接合大体水平的地板表面F时,含有污物的空气基本上垂直向下通过主要空气入口70并且进入到主体12内。已经通过设备110从空气流分离的污物大体垂直向上通过污物出口113并进入到腔室100内,在所述腔室100内,所述污物在重力作用下掉落到腔室100的下部部分。The dirt outlet 113 is configured to direct dirt into the chamber 100 in a direction 111 generally opposite to the direction of air entering the main air inlet 70 . Specifically, the dirt is directed into the primary air inlet 70 generally anti-parallel to the direction of air flow. By way of illustration, when the apparatus is in operation and the two wheels 14, 16 engage a generally horizontal floor surface F, dirt laden air passes substantially vertically downward through the main air inlet 70 and into the main body 12. . Dirt that has been separated from the air stream by the device 110 passes generally vertically upwards through the dirt outlet 113 and into the chamber 100 where it falls under gravity to the bottom of the chamber 100. lower part.
所述污物出口113的配置/位置是有利的,因为它减少污物出口113由于污物堆积在腔室100内而被堵塞的风险。如下文将描述的那样,设备10包括装置80,其用于限制主体12围绕其轴线A的旋转运动。偏置装置80,虽然不是必须的,也协助污物出口113定位,以确保它不围绕轴线A旋转地太远以至于不能减少堵塞的可能性。The configuration/location of the dirt outlet 113 is advantageous because it reduces the risk of the dirt outlet 113 being blocked due to dirt accumulating inside the chamber 100 . The device 10 includes means 80 for limiting the rotational movement of the body 12 about its axis A, as will be described hereinafter. Biasing means 80, although not required, also assists in the positioning of dirt outlet 113 to ensure that it does not rotate too far about axis A to reduce the likelihood of clogging.
如可从图中看出的那样,主体12还容纳第二旋风分离器装置210,其包括围绕轴线A定位成阵列的多个较小的旋风分离器211。这样的装置在本领域内是公知的。每个装置211具有与第一旋风分离装置110的出口114流体连通的切向入口212,以及污物出口213。污物出口213与主体内的空间214连通,所述空间214给从分离器211分离的污物提供存储体积。如可在图12b和图15中看出的那样,空间214与在轮14后终止的轴向延伸通道215连通。As can be seen from the figure, the main body 12 also houses a second cyclone arrangement 210 comprising a plurality of smaller cyclones 211 positioned in an array about the axis A. As shown in FIG. Such devices are well known in the art. Each device 211 has a tangential inlet 212 in fluid communication with the outlet 114 of the first cyclonic separating device 110 , and a dirt outlet 213 . The dirt outlet 213 communicates with a space 214 inside the body, which provides a storage volume for dirt separated from the separator 211 . As can be seen in FIGS. 12 b and 15 , the space 214 communicates with an axially extending channel 215 terminating behind the wheel 14 .
通道215终止于入口216处,入口216邻近于通到腔室100的入口101定位。这两个入口101,216可通过盖19的移动而被关闭/打开。盖19通过枢转连接19a而枢转连接到主体12,并且可在关闭和打开位置之间移动。盖19包括基本上相对于所述枢转连接19a定位的突出部分19b,其与捕获部分50a接合以便将盖19保持在其关闭位置下(在下文更详细地描述)。在其关闭位置下,所述盖挡住入口101,216,但是在其打开位置下,所述盖允许用以清空容纳在腔室100和通道215内的污物。Channel 215 terminates at inlet 216 , which is located adjacent to inlet 101 to chamber 100 . The two inlets 101 , 216 can be closed/opened by movement of the cover 19 . The cover 19 is pivotally connected to the main body 12 by a pivot connection 19a, and is movable between closed and open positions. Lid 19 includes a protruding portion 19b positioned substantially relative to said pivot connection 19a, which engages catch portion 50a to retain lid 19 in its closed position (described in more detail below). In its closed position, the cover blocks the inlets 101 , 216 , but in its open position it allows for emptying of the dirt contained in the chamber 100 and the channel 215 .
每个装置211具有与支撑马达前过滤器90的空间连通的空气出口217。空气过滤器90可通过在主体12外表面中的孔91从主体12移除(参见图6)。这确保过滤器90在必要的时候可被清洁和/或更换。Each device 211 has an air outlet 217 communicating with the space supporting the pre-motor filter 90 . The air filter 90 is removable from the body 12 through a hole 91 in the outer surface of the body 12 (see FIG. 6 ). This ensures that the filter 90 can be cleaned and/or replaced when necessary.
吸力马达140定位在主体12内,吸力马达140具有可驱动地连接到吸入式风扇150的转子141。这些组成部件沿着主体12的轴线A定位,并且当被供电时,提供合适的吸力源以便将空气抽吸通过主要空气入口70,第一旋风分离装置110,第二旋风分离装置210和过滤器90。马达后过滤器160邻近吸力马达140的后端部(轮16附近)定位,其由连接到主体12的盖构件161覆盖。空气通过该另外的过滤器160和盖部分161中的孔到达大气。盖161是可移除的,使得过滤器160在必要的时候可被清洁和/或更换。Positioned within the main body 12 is a suction motor 140 having a rotor 141 drivably connected to the suction fan 150 . These components are positioned along the axis A of the main body 12 and, when powered, provide a suitable source of suction to draw air through the main air inlet 70, the first cyclone 110, the second cyclone 210 and the filter 90. A post-motor filter 160 is located adjacent to the rear end of the suction motor 140 (near the wheel 16 ), which is covered by a cover member 161 connected to the main body 12 . Air passes through this further filter 160 and holes in the cover part 161 to the atmosphere. Cover 161 is removable so that filter 160 can be cleaned and/or replaced when necessary.
设备10还包括电缆存储装置170,用于存储用于给吸力马达140供电的电缆68。在当前实例中,电缆存储装置170包括环形的可移动部件171,其能够围绕轴线A围绕吸力马达140的壳体旋转。在当前的实例中,电缆存储装置170包括用于偏置将被拉入到主体12内部中的电缆68的装置,使得电缆围绕环形部件171卷绕。Apparatus 10 also includes cable storage 170 for storing cables 68 for powering suction motor 140 . In the present example, the cable storage device 170 comprises an annular movable part 171 , which is rotatable about the axis A around the housing of the suction motor 140 . In the present example, the cable storage device 170 includes means for biasing the cable 68 to be drawn into the interior of the body 12 such that the cable is coiled around the ring member 171 .
电缆68的自由端连接到插头69,其中当电缆68被完全存储时,插头69被至少部分地接收在主体12中的凹部67内。电缆存储装置170围绕吸力马达140的壳体定位确保非常紧凑的结构。The free end of the cable 68 is connected to a plug 69 which is at least partially received within a recess 67 in the body 12 when the cable 68 is fully stored. The positioning of the cable storage device 170 around the housing of the suction motor 140 ensures a very compact construction.

如前面所提及的那样,设备10包括用于将主体偏置到相对于待被清洁的表面F的第一位置的装置80。具体地,偏置装置80配置成将所述主体12偏置到其中主要空气入口70基本上垂直地倾斜的位置。更具体地,偏置装置80包括为支撑以便围绕相应轴线旋转的一对轮81,82形式的第一地面接合构件和第二地面接合构件。每个轮81,82通过一对可枢转移动的构件84,85,87,88连接到主体。构件或臂85,88包括接收轮81,82的分叉端部部分,以及臂85,88的相对端部可枢转地相对于所述主体进行支撑。构件或臂84,87通过孔86,89可枢转地在一端部处连接到轮81,82,而每个臂84,87的相对端部相对于主体12可枢转和可滑动地移动。臂84,87通过将轮81,82朝向彼此偏置的偏置装置连接到彼此。As mentioned before, the device 10 comprises means 80 for biasing the body into a first position relative to the surface F to be cleaned. In particular, the biasing means 80 is configured to bias the body 12 into a position wherein the primary air inlet 70 is substantially vertically inclined. More specifically, the biasing means 80 includes first and second ground engaging members in the form of a pair of wheels 81 , 82 supported for rotation about respective axes. Each wheel 81 , 82 is connected to the main body by a pair of pivotally movable members 84 , 85 , 87 , 88 . Members or arms 85, 88 include bifurcated end portions that receive wheels 81, 82, and opposite ends of arms 85, 88 are pivotally supported relative to the body. Members or arms 84 , 87 are pivotally connected at one end to wheels 81 , 82 by holes 86 , 89 , while the opposite end of each arm 84 , 87 is pivotally and slidably movable relative to body 12 . The arms 84, 87 are connected to each other by biasing means that bias the wheels 81, 82 towards each other.
轮81,82因此每个定位在主体轴线A的一侧,并且可在方向M1,M2上、在该具体实例中垂直于主体12的轴线A横向移动。The wheels 81 , 82 are thus each positioned on one side of the axis A of the body and are movable laterally in directions M1 , M2 perpendicular to the axis A of the body 12 in this particular example.
在该特定实例中,偏置机构是弹簧(未示出),其横向于主体12的轴线A在臂84,87之间延伸。In this particular example, the biasing mechanism is a spring (not shown) extending transversely to the axis A of the body 12 between the arms 84 , 87 .
虽然在当前实例中,偏置装置80连接到主体12的中央区域C,但是它可设置在沿着主体12的任何位置处。Although in the present example, the biasing device 80 is attached to the central region C of the body 12 , it may be positioned anywhere along the body 12 .
在图20中,示出轮81,82处于相应的第一状态下,其对应于主要空气入口70基本上垂直地对准。图9和图10示出当主体12在围绕其轴线A在任一方向上旋转时轮81,82的运动。图9是通过看向轮16的主体12的端部横截面视图,其中主体已围绕轴线A逆时针旋转。可以看出的是,轮81保持与表面F相接触,但臂87,88向外枢转,从而允许轮81运动。也可以看出的是,轮82不再与地板表面F接合。In FIG. 20 , the wheels 81 , 82 are shown in a respective first state, which corresponds to the main air inlet 70 being substantially vertically aligned. Figures 9 and 10 show the movement of the wheels 81, 82 when the body 12 is rotated about its axis A in either direction. FIG. 9 is an end cross-sectional view through the body 12 looking towards the wheel 16 where the body has been rotated about the axis A counterclockwise. It can be seen that the wheel 81 remains in contact with the surface F, but the arms 87, 88 pivot outwardly allowing the wheel 81 to move. It can also be seen that the wheels 82 are no longer engaged with the floor surface F. FIG.
在图10中,主体已围绕轴线A顺时针旋转,其导致轮82保持与地板表面F接触,其中臂84,85向外枢转,但轮81不再与地板表面F接合。In Fig. 10 the body has been rotated clockwise about axis A which has caused the wheel 82 to remain in contact with the floor surface F with the arms 84, 85 pivoting outwards but the wheel 81 no longer engaging the floor surface F.
在图9和图10中所示的配置需要用户凭借拉动软管20而将旋转力施加到主体。当用户拉动软管20以便使得主体12沿着地板表面F移动时,上述将会发生,其中轮14,16围绕它们相应的轴线旋转。一旦用户减小或去除施加到主体12上的力,则偏置装置80被配置成使得所述主体围绕其轴线A旋转到中立状态,其中主要空气入口70大体垂直定位。对轮81,82的运动的限制确保主体12,特别是第一旋风分离装置110的腔室112中不会围绕轴线A旋转地太远,以确保污物通过出口113自由地离开腔室112并当污物被收集时进入腔室100内。The configuration shown in FIGS. 9 and 10 requires the user to apply rotational force to the body by pulling on the hose 20 . This will occur when the user pulls on the hose 20 to move the body 12 along the floor surface F, with the wheels 14, 16 rotating about their respective axes. Once the user reduces or removes the force applied to the body 12, the biasing means 80 is configured to cause the body to rotate about its axis A to a neutral position with the primary air inlet 70 positioned generally vertically. The restriction of the movement of the wheels 81, 82 ensures that the main body 12, and in particular the chamber 112 of the first cyclonic separation device 110, does not rotate too far around the axis A to ensure that the dirt leaves the chamber 112 freely through the outlet 113 and The dirt enters the chamber 100 as it is collected.
从图也可以看出的是主体的面向地板表面的凹入形状提供用于提供偏置装置80的空间,其提供该设备的紧凑结构,同时保持主体内部中的足够体积以便容纳设备10的操作组件。It can also be seen from the figure that the concave shape of the floor facing surface of the body provides space for providing a biasing means 80 which provides a compact structure of the device while maintaining sufficient volume in the interior of the body to accommodate the operation of the device 10 components.
有利地,设备10包括连接到主体12的多个偏转器构件41,42,43,44。偏转器构件41,42,43,44的目的是给主体12提供保护,此外协助用户在清洁的同时操纵设备。偏转器构件41,42,43,44有利地协助用户操纵设备移动经过固定的对象,例如门框,椅子,桌子(参见图21)。Advantageously, the device 10 comprises a plurality of deflector members 41 , 42 , 43 , 44 connected to the main body 12 . The purpose of the deflector members 41 , 42 , 43 , 44 is to provide protection to the main body 12 and further assist the user in manipulating the device while cleaning. The deflector members 41, 42, 43, 44 advantageously assist the user in manipulating the device to move past fixed objects, such as door frames, chairs, tables (see Figure 21).

现在参照图21,其示出根据当前实施例的偏转器构件的一个优点。当用户使用该设备10时,他们通常会拉动软管20,以便使得主体沿着地板表面F移动。可通常是下述情况,即用户从一个房间例如通过门口移动到另一个房间,并可良好地将设备与框架(“对象”)接合。在现有技术的设备中,也可以是下述情况,即该设备的主体会被卡在对象后面,并且用户随后不得不手动横向移动设备以避开对象。然而,偏转器构件,特别是偏转器构件41,42,确保即使当设备的主体接合这样的对象时,施加到软管20上的力P导致设备10在Q方向上移动,因为偏转器构件提供滑动表面,其滑动经过提供所述阻碍的对象。Reference is now made to FIG. 21 , which illustrates one advantage of the deflector member according to the current embodiment. When users use the device 10, they typically pull on the hose 20 in order to move the main body along the floor surface F. As shown in FIG. It may often be the case that the user moves from one room to another, for example through a doorway, and can engage the device well with the frame ("object"). In prior art devices, it could also be the case that the body of the device would get stuck behind an object and the user would then have to manually move the device laterally to avoid the object. However, the deflector members, in particular the deflector members 41, 42, ensure that even when the body of the device engages such an object, the force P applied to the hose 20 causes the device 10 to move in the direction Q, since the deflector members provide A sliding surface which slides over the object providing said hindrance.
用户可操作的控制件50,56在偏转器构件41,42的空间或凹部内的定位可确保它们在一定程度上受到保护,防止由于设备和固定对象之间的碰撞导致的任何损害。The positioning of the user-operable controls 50, 56 within the spaces or recesses of the deflector members 41, 42 ensures that they are somewhat protected against any damage due to collisions between the device and the fixed object.
具体参照图22至图24,这些示出设备的第二实施例,其利用本发明的各方面。与第一实施例共同的组件和特征被给予相同的参考标号外加撇号。当与第一实施例相比的唯一区别是设备10'具有用于接收污物的腔室100',其可在平行于和共轴于主体12'的轴线A'的方向上移除。这确保用户可移除腔室100',并将其带到垃圾箱等以便清空其内容物。图22至图24示出处于其被移除位置下的腔室100'。可以看出的是,腔室100'包括手柄105,以协助用户将其从设备的其余部分移除。腔室100'是大体圆柱形的(如图23和图24中所示),并且支撑在主体12内的凹部106内。通到凹部106的入口通过支撑轮14'的主体12'的端部开口设置。Referring specifically to Figures 22 to 24, these illustrate a second embodiment of an apparatus utilizing aspects of the present invention. Components and features in common with the first embodiment are given the same reference numbers plus a prime. The only difference when compared with the first embodiment is that the device 10' has a chamber 100' for receiving dirt, which is removable in a direction parallel and coaxial to the axis A' of the body 12'. This ensures that the user can remove the chamber 100' and take it to a waste bin or the like to empty its contents. Figures 22 to 24 show the chamber 100' in its removed position. As can be seen, the chamber 100' includes a handle 105 to assist the user in removing it from the rest of the device. Chamber 100 ′ is generally cylindrical (as shown in FIGS. 23 and 24 ) and is supported within a recess 106 within body 12 . Access to the recess 106 is provided through the end opening of the body 12' of the support wheel 14'.
